CARE AND CLEANING

1.  Unplug the Coffee Maker and allow it cool before cleaning. 

2.  It is recommended to check the Drip Tray regularly for excess water or  

  coffee. Empty the Drip Tray and wipe it clean using a damp cloth.  

  Use extra care when removing or emptying the Drip Tray to prevent  

 spilling.

3.  Remove used coffee capsules or coffee grounds from the Chamber.

4.  Wipe the outside surfaces of the Coffee Maker with a damp cloth, 

  then dry thoroughly.  

  NEVER use har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aning pads. 

  NEVER immerse the Coffee Maker in water or any other liquid.

5.  All servicing, other than cleaning, should be performed by an   

  authorized service representative. See Warranty section.  

Descaling

Over a period of time, minerals and calcium found in water will 

accumulate in your Coffee Maker and may affect optimal operation.   

The appliance should be cleaned approximately every three (3) months, 

depending on water conditions.  Use distilled vinegar in the following 

manner to remove the mineral deposits:

1.  Fill the Water Reservoir to the maximum Water Line (14 oz) with  

  equal parts of white vinegar and cold water. Close the Top lid.  

2.  Place a large cup on the Drip Try beneath the Brew Spout.

  NOTE: ENSURE THERE IS NO GROUND COFFEE OR CAPSULES  

  IN THE BREW CHAMBER WHEN DESCALING.

3.  Press the Capsule Brew & Ground Coffee Brew Buttons at the same  

  time. Both Buttons will illuminate. The Coffee Maker will begin  

  pumping water with intermittent pauses in between cycles. There  

  are 5 cycles of approximately 30 seconds each. Once all 5 cycles are  

  completed the Coffee Maker will turn OFF. 

4.  Allow the unit to rest. Discard the liquid from the coffee cup. Use  

  extreme caution as the contents may  be hot.
